What Exactly Is a TRS Cable and When Do You Need One?
TRS stands for Tip-Ring-Sleeve, a three-conductor connector configuration that supports balanced audio signals. Unlike a TS (Tip-Sleeve) cable, which carries an unbalanced signal, a TRS cable carries two signal conductors plus a ground—hot (+), cold (−), and ground—and can reject electromagnetic interference. This makes TRS cables essential in studio wiring, pro audio patchbays, and any situation where cables run more than a few meters. Common applications include:
- Studio monitors – Balanced connections from interface to powered speakers.
- Headphone outputs – Many pro headphones use TRS or TRRS connectors.
- Insert cables – Send and return signals in mixing consoles via a single TRS connector.
- Patchbay wiring – Half-normalled or full-normalled patch points rely on balanced TRS.
- DI boxes and instrument lines – Active DI boxes often have a TRS output.
Because balanced lines reject noise, TRS cables are standard in any pro environment where signal integrity matters. That’s why buying from a reputable brand is not just about prestige—it’s about ensuring that your gear hears the intended sound, not unwanted hum and buzz.
Top Brands for Reliable TRS Cables (Expanded)
While the original article touched on four brands, the professional audio world offers many more that deserve attention. Below we expand the list with detailed reasoning, construction highlights, and typical use cases.
1. Mogami – The Studio Standard
Mogami is widely considered the gold standard for studio cabling. Their TRS cables use oxygen-free copper (OFC) conductors and their signature spiral shielding, which eliminates microphonic noise when cables are moved. Mogami cables are flexible without being flimsy, and the connectors—often Neutrik or Rean—are compression-fitted to the cable, preventing stress fractures. For engineers who record delicate acoustic sources or high-gain electric guitars, Mogami’s low noise floor is priceless. A direct link to their product line shows the breadth of configurations (Mogami TRS cables). The price premium is noticeable, but for a cable that might last a decade in a studio, it is a worthwhile investment.
2. Canare – Broadcast and Live Industry Favorite
Canare is a Japanese manufacturer known for bulletproof cables used in broadcast, film, and live sound. Their L-4E6S star-quad cable is legendary for its common-mode rejection—it can eliminate hum in electrically noisy environments. Canare TRS cables often use their own connectors with a robust strain relief that grips the jacket tightly. For live sound engineers who need to coil and uncoil cables hundreds of times a year, Canare’s durability is unmatched. Many rental houses stock Canare because it survives abuse. Balanced TRS quad cables are slightly stiffer than Mogami but offer exceptional interference rejection (Canare audio cables).
3. Neutrik – The Connector Gold Standard
While Neutrik is primarily a connector manufacturer, they also produce finished cable assemblies under the Neutrik brand. Their TRS cables use the famous XX series connectors, which feature a die-cast shell, nickel or gold plating, and a chuck-type strain relief that grips the cable braid. Neutrik cables are the industry standard for reliability in high-cycle environments like live sound, recording studios, and touring racks. If you’ve ever plugged into a stage panel, you’ve likely used a Neutrik connector. Their finished cables are similarly tough, with the same attention to contact integrity. A great resource is their cable configurator (Neutrik cable assemblies).
4. Belden – The Workhorse of Installation
Belden is a giant in the world of industrial and broadcast cabling. Their audio cables (such as 9451 and 88760) are standard for installation inside walls, patchbays, and console wiring. Belden cables often use a foil plus braid shield for maximum coverage, and the conductors are 24 AWG or thicker stranded copper. While Belden does not sell pre-terminated TRS cables widely, many custom shop builders and pro integrators terminate Belden bulk cable with Neutrik connectors. If you are building your own patch cables or wiring a studio, Belden is an excellent choice. The company has extensive technical documentation (Belden audio cable selection).
5. Hosa Technology – Accessible and Consistent
Hosa Technology offers TRS cables that bridge the gap between low-quality consumer cables and expensive pro gear. Their cables use 22 AWG oxygen-free copper, foil shielding, and nickel-plated plugs with an internal strain relief molded onto the cable. Hosa cables are widely used in educational institutions, home studios, and entry-level setups. They are not the quietest or most flexible, but they deliver consistent performance at a price point that allows buying multiple lengths without breaking the bank. For a student or a small project studio, Hosa is a smart starting point.
6. Pro Co – The Stage Survivor
Pro Co manufactures the famous “Pro Co 155” series, often used in live sound and rental. Their TRS cables are heavy-duty, with a thick PVC jacket that resists cuts, and a dual shield (braid + foil) that keeps noise out. The connectors are typically from Neutrik or Switchcraft, with a metal barrel and a spring-loaded strain relief. Pro Co cables are heavier and less flexible than Mogami, but they can withstand being stepped on, coiled roughly, and stored in bins. For a monitor engineer who expects cables to be abused, Pro Co is a wise choice. They also offer custom lengths with a quick turnaround.
7. Livewire (by Audio-Technica) – A Versatile Mid-Range Option
Livewire is a house brand from Audio-Technica that provides professional TRS cables at a competitive price. Their cables feature a braided or foil shield depending on the series, and the connectors are over-molded for durability. Livewire cables are popular in regional sound companies and installs because they offer a reasonable noise floor and adequate flexibility. They are not as expensive as Mogami but outperform generic bargain cables. The Elite series, in particular, uses a balanced design with 24k gold-plated plugs and oxygen-free copper.
8. Seismic Audio – Low-Cost Practicality
Seismic Audio has carved out a niche in the budget-friendly market. Their TRS cables are often sold in multi-packs, and the build quality is adequate for practice rooms, church sound, or as backup cables. They use a TRS connector with a molded housing and a thin copper shield. These cables will work for basic line-level connections where extreme low noise is not critical. However, they are less forgiving in high-RF environments or when used with sensitive preamps. For the price, they are a reasonable stopgap, but serious professionals will outgrow them quickly.
9. Sommer Cable – European Precision
Sommer Cable, a German manufacturer, produces TRS cables that are widely respected in Europe and increasingly in North America. Their SC-Spirit XXL and SC-One series are popular for both studio and stage. Sommer uses high-density braided shields, soft PVC jackets, and high-purity copper. Many boutique cable builders use Sommer bulk cable as a premium alternative to Mogami. Sommer cables are known for their flexibility and low handling noise. For engineers who want European quality, Sommer is a top choice.
10. Custom Shop Builders (e.g., BTPA, Evidence Audio)
If off-the-shelf cables do not meet your needs, custom builders like BTPA (Best-Tronics) or Evidence Audio offer made-to-order TRS cables with your choice of connectors, length, cable type, and even color. These shops often use Mogami, Canare, or Belden bulk cable with Neutrik, Switchcraft, or Amphenol connectors. Custom cables ensure you get exactly the length and angle (straight or right-angle) you need, which reduces clutter and stress on jacks. For rack wiring or patchbay snakes, this is the ultimate solution.
Key Technical Factors to Consider Before Buying
Beyond brand reputation, you should understand what makes a TRS cable perform well in your specific setup. The following factors directly affect signal quality, noise rejection, and longevity.
Shielding Type
Most TRS cables use one of three shielding types:
- Spiral shield – A wrapped wire braid that provides 100% coverage and high flexibility. Excellent for studio use where cables are moved infrequently. Mogami uses spiral shielding.
- Braid shield – A woven mesh of tinned copper that offers superior durability and flexibility. Slightly less coverage than spiral but more robust for live use. Canare and Pro Co use braids.
- Foil shield – A thin aluminum layer wrapped around the conductors with a drain wire. Provides full coverage but is prone to cracking if the cable is flexed repeatedly. Common in cheaper cables.
- Foil + braid – The best of both worlds: a foil for full coverage and a braid to handle flex and add strength. Pro Co 155 and Belden 9451 use this combination.
For balanced lines (which already reject noise), any of these shields works, but in high-RF areas (near cell towers, dimmer racks, or computers), braid + foil provides the most protection.
Conductor Material and Gauge
Oxygen-free copper (OFC) is standard in pro cables. It reduces oxidation and maintains conductivity. But gauge matters more than many realize. Thicker wire (lower AWG number) has lower resistance and can carry signal over longer distances without high-frequency loss. For TRS cables longer than 20 feet, use at least 24 AWG. Thinner wire (26 AWG or 28 AWG) is fine for short patch cables (1–3 feet). Cheap cables often use CCA (copper-clad aluminum) which has higher resistance and is brittle—avoid them.
Connector Quality
The connector is the weakest link in any cable. Look for:
- Metal housing – Provides better grounding and durability than plastic.
- Chuck-type strain relief – Grips the cable jacket and braid, not just the insulation, preventing pull-out.
- Gold or nickel plating – Both are fine; gold resists corrosion better but nickel is more durable for frequent plugging.
- Internal construction – Contact tips soldered to the conductors, not crimped. Neutrik, Switchcraft, and Rean are the top connector brands.
When evaluating a brand, check if they use Neutrik connectors (a good sign) or generic molded connectors. The latter are prone to failure after a few months of use.
Impedance and Balanced Design
TRS cables are designed for balanced audio, which typically uses a nominal impedance of 110 ohms for digital or 600 ohms for analog (though analog is usually 10–100 kΩ input impedance, so cable impedance is not critical). The key is that the two signal conductors should be twisted together to reject interference. Quality cables (like Canare L-4E6S) use star-quad construction: four conductors twisted and arranged to cancel magnetic interference. This is why some brands are better in noisy environments.
How to Test and Maintain Your TRS Cables
Even the best brands can develop issues over time. A simple continuity test with a multimeter will catch most problems:
- Measure resistance between the tip of one plug and the tip of the other. Should be near 0 ohms (less than 1 Ω).
- Same for ring and sleeve.
- Check that tip does not short to ring or sleeve. Infinite resistance is ideal.
If you get intermittent cuts, the likely culprit is the solder joint at the connector or a broken wire inside the strain relief. For maintenance, avoid tight kinks, wrap cables using over-under technique, and store them in a dry, clean bag. Connector cleaning with DeoxIT can prevent oxidation on gold or nickel contacts.
Balanced vs. Unbalanced: TRS vs. TS
Many musicians confuse TRS and TS connectors. They look similar, but TRS has two black rings on the barrel (the tip ring) whereas TS has only one. Using a TS cable in a balanced output will cause signal cancellation and loss of level. Conversely, using a TRS cable for an unbalanced instrument can work but may cause noise issues if the ring contacts ground improperly. Always match the jack type to the cable. Most audio interfaces label outputs “balanced” or “TRS” – use a TRS cable there. For guitars and pedals, TS is correct.
Where to Buy: Retailers vs. Bulk Cable
Buying pre-made cables is convenient, but if you have specific lengths, consider buying bulk cable and connectors and having them terminated professionally (or doing it yourself if you have soldering skills). Many online retailers like Redco, BTPA, or Markertek offer custom lengths with your choice of connectors. This can be cost-effective for a studio install where you need many cables of exact length. Some brands, like Mogami and Canare, sell bulk cable separately.

Conclusion: The Right Brand for Your Needs
There is no single best brand for every musician or engineer. The choice depends on your environment, budget, and durability requirements:
- If you need the quietest possible signal for critical mixing and tracking, Mogami or Sommer are unbeatable.
- If you work in live sound or broadcast, Canare or Pro Co will survive years of abuse.
- If you are building a studio from scratch, Belden bulk cable with Neutrik connectors is a proven install solution.
- If you are on a tight budget, Hosa or Seismic Audio will get the job done for non-critical connections.
- If you want a one-stop solution for varied needs, Livewire (Audio-Technica) offers a good balance.
Regardless of brand, always inspect the cable for workmanship, avoid extreme bends, and test regularly. A high-quality TRS cable is an investment that will serve you for years, preserving the sound that you work so hard to perfect.
